总结:This research examines the growth of the V2O5 nanorods (NRs) by using spray pyrolysis method, and then fabricates photodetector with pH-EGFET sensor devices based on the V2O5 NRs. In addition the surface morphology, structural, and optical properties of the V2O5 NRs were studied. In the beginning, the V2O5 NRs growth was studied onto two substrates, silicon and glass. After which, the influence of substrate temperature, solution concentration, and deposition rate on the physical properties of the V2O5 NRs were examined.
